The Rise of Natural Colors in Footwear
In recent years, the sneaker industry has witnessed a significant shift towards natural colors, particularly hues like beige, brown, and other earth tones. This growing trend is largely fueled by evolving consumer preferences, as individuals gravitate towards versatile aesthetics that seamlessly integrate into their wardrobes. Natural colors not only bring an understated elegance to footwear but also offer a sense of timelessness, making them appealing to a wider audience across different demographics.
One of the key factors driving this shift is the increasing demand for minimalist designs within the sneaker market. As streetwear culture continues to influence fashion, consumers are beginning to prioritize classic silhouettes adorned with neutral color palettes. Sneakers in shades of brown and beige can be effortlessly styled with various outfits, from casual to semi-formal looks, providing wearers with ample styling opportunities. This versatility has sparked a surge in the popularity of models that embrace these tones, making them a staple in many sneakerheads’ collections.

Introducing the Air Jordan 1 High Mocha
The Air Jordan 1 High Mocha is an impressive addition to the long-standing Air Jordan legacy, continuing the tradition of innovation and style that sneaker enthusiasts have come to expect. This sneaker features a balanced design with a harmonious combination of black, white, and brown hues, offering a contemporary aesthetic that appeals to a broad range of fashion tastes. The primary leather upper is predominantly black, providing a striking yet subtle contrast to the clean white midsole, while accents of rich mocha brown add a layer of sophistication to the overall look.
Scheduled for release in October 2023, the Air Jordan 1 High Mocha quickly garnered attention among sneaker collectors and fashion-forward individuals alike. Its anticipated launch has sparked excitement in the sneaker community, indicating the high demand and desirability associated with this model. The distinctive color palette not only aligns well with seasonal trends but also ensures versatility when it comes to styling. The sneaker’s silhouette is timeless, making it easily adaptable to various styles, whether paired with casual streetwear or more polished outfits.
Key features of the Air Jordan 1 High Mocha include its cushioned midsole that provides comfort during extended wear, as well as a padded collar for added support. Additionally, the iconic Air Jordan branding on the tongue and heel pays homage to the brand’s heritage, enhancing its appeal among dedicated fans.
